Two-phase test against a DTR-reset board: phase A forces sub-threshold
retransmits (NAK the completed reply frame -> exactly one counted
retransmit, then ACK the retry), where the display must hold F0000000;
phase B withholds ACKs for a full give-up cycle to cross the threshold,
with the expected E0 readout predicted from observed traffic.
Bench findings while building it (9600, e0t5 chip): the reply-retry
machine sends 5 retransmits per cycle (not 4); responses are honored
only after the complete reply frame (mid-frame ACK/NAK/RESTART is
ignored); once the first retry fires the cycle runs blind to give-up;
a host NAK triggers an immediate counted retransmit.
